Hey Mitch, can you explain more about what you meant when you were talking selling your AMD shares and "rebalancing" your portfolio? I'd be really interested to hear more about this. Thank you :)
@MitchShoesmith
@MitchShoesmith 6 месяцев назад
Hey Emma, because AMD stock has gained proportionately more than my other positions my overall weighting in the portfolio for AMD has increased, essentially by selling some shares I would reduce my allocation (taking some profit too) and redistribute funds to other investments to keep things “balanced”. Hope that makes sense! Happy to answer any questions ☺️

@@MitchShoesmith how does the rule of 4% work my brother ? If you don’t mind me asking ?
@MitchShoesmith
@MitchShoesmith 6 месяцев назад
@@UNKNOWN-1589 if you do your future portfolio value and multiply it by 4%, that’s the typical rule of thumb for how much you could withdraw from your portfolio without it losing value. E.g. a £1,000,000 portfolio x 4% withdrawal rate = £40,000 per year to live off.

Hey mitch quick Q. i see you have large shares in S&P 500 index but also individual stocks in amazon tesla etc. how does that benefit your portfolio if those individual stocks are already in the s&p 500? Im new to this lol. Wouldn’t have been easier if just upped your shares in s&p funds
@MitchShoesmith
@MitchShoesmith 6 месяцев назад
Hey, it’s a fair question, the S&P500 is a weighted index so it is more weighted towards the like of Amazon, Apple etc… but individually if we take Apple for example, it probably only has about a 7 or 8% weighting in the S&P500, so the proportionate exposure is far lower than me buying individual shares and having 100% exposure. The aim being those individual stocks hopefully outperform the index (and therefore the other 490+ other companies) that I hold within the index. Hope I’ve explained that ok!
